What would be the best house rule for rolling on hilt drops in all-DG runs?
We had a chat in an all-DG PoS full trash clear group today, and came up with "Roll need to use on your main" ie someone there with an alt can roll in order to give to their main to do the quest line.
Folks who already have a hilt on their main, or who want it for an alt or to sell, would not roll need by that rule. Mondalow has gotten a hilt and was there with an alt, and said that was cool with him.
Every 5-man can set its own rules, though it's best to have a word about what the expectation will be before you start. Just thought it'd be good to start a thread so we can all see what each other are thinking.
Note: when one or more pugs are in the group, there's no way for us to know if they're rolling to AH or give to an alt or what. However some still consider it unsporting to roll on a hilt when you've already gotten on. So with pugs I think the rule should either be "all roll need" or "roll if you haven't gotten one".
